The Practice: Hot, High-Intensity Flows
The primary offering at They Flow is infrared hot yoga, with studio temperatures maintained between 100-105°F. Visitors describe the heat as deepening the practice, enhancing focus, and creating a cleansing, rejuvenating effect. The classes are dynamic and challenging, blending elements of traditional yoga with invigorating, heart-pumping sequences. While the studio’s own materials mention styles like Vinyasa and power yoga, and class names such as Ignite Flow, Core Blaze, Balance Inferno, and Zen Blaze, visitors specifically highlight the intensity and the skillful guidance through flows. People note that instructors provide clear cues, demonstrate correct form, and offer modifications to accommodate different skill levels, ensuring the practice remains accessible yet demanding.
A distinctive feature that visitors enthusiastically mention is the cold plunge water therapy available post-class. This contrast therapy is described as perfect for reducing inflammation, accelerating muscle recovery, and leaving one feeling refreshed and invigorated after the intense heat. Other appreciated amenities include mat and towel rentals, though visitors are encouraged to bring their own. The studio operates on a cashless system and has specific policies, such as opening 15 minutes before class and not allowing late entry, which contribute to a structured and mindful environment. People also note delightful finishing touches, like cold towels and crystal rocks at the end of a session, which add to the overall sense of care and intentionality.
